Cooling device for accessory injection mold
By introducing a spiral shaft and impeller structure into the injection mold, the laminar boundary layer of the thermal oil is broken. Combined with air cooling and temperature monitoring, the problem of uneven contact of the thermal oil is solved, efficient heat exchange and cooling effects are achieved, and production efficiency is improved.

[0001] The present invention relates to the technical field of injection molds, and in particular to a cooling device for an accessory injection mold. Background Art
[0002] Accessory injection molds are tools used to produce various plastic accessories. They are widely used in many industries such as automobiles, electronics, home appliances, and medical equipment. Through the injection molding process, plastic parts with complex shapes and stable dimensions can be manufactured efficiently and accurately.
[0003] During the injection molding process, some plastic waste such as scraps and defective products will inevitably be generated. These plastic wastes can be reprocessed into pellets or other forms of raw materials and used again in injection molding production, thereby reducing dependence on original resources.
[0004] After the plastic melt is injected into the mold, it needs to be quickly cooled and solidified to form the desired shape. An effective cooling system can speed up this process, thereby shortening the time of each production cycle and improving the overall efficiency of the production line.
[0005] Currently, during the injection molding process, the mold is mainly cooled by liquid cooling. Thermal oil is injected into the mold through an oil pump to cool the mold. However, the flow of thermal oil is relatively smooth and has less fluctuation, forming a laminar boundary layer in a static state. As a result, part of the thermal oil cannot contact the mold, resulting in low heat exchange efficiency, which affects the overall cooling efficiency. Summary of the Invention
[0006] In view of this, the present invention provides a cooling device for an accessory injection mold, which can overcome the shortcomings that the flow of heat transfer oil is relatively smooth and has less fluctuation, forming a laminar boundary layer in a static state, resulting in a part of the heat transfer oil being unable to contact the mold, resulting in low heat exchange efficiency, thereby affecting the overall cooling efficiency.

[0015] Compared with the prior art, the present invention has the following advantages: 1. The present invention can suck the heat transfer oil into the oil outlet pipe through the oil pump, and then the heat transfer oil flows into the heat transfer pipe. The heat transfer oil can cool the static mold and the movable mold, so that the injection molded part is cooled and solidified. The heat transfer oil can drive the impeller to rotate, and the impeller drives the spiral shaft to rotate. The spiral shaft can stir the heat transfer oil, so that the heat transfer oil forms a complex flow pattern, breaks the laminar boundary layer in the static state, and allows more heat transfer oil to contact the surface of the static mold and the movable mold, thereby improving the heat exchange efficiency and thus improving the overall cooling efficiency.
[0016] 2. Cold air can be filled into the first outlet pipe through the air cooler, and the cold air enters the wavy groove through the second outlet pipe. The cold air flows along the wavy groove. The wavy groove can disperse the heat flow path, reduce local hot spots, avoid excessive temperature gradients, and thus reduce the risk of thermal stress.
[0017] 3. The temperature of the dynamic mold and the static mold can be detected by the temperature sensor, and the data can be fed back to the controller so that the staff can understand the temperature of the dynamic mold and the static mold, and it is convenient for the staff to cool the dynamic mold and the static mold to the appropriate range to ensure the quality of the injection molded parts. [0040] The staff injects the heat-conducting oil into the oil tank 13 through the oil inlet pipe 14, and then injects the material into the static mold 3, and then controls the movable end of the hydraulic cylinder 8 to extend, driving the sliding frame 5 to move downward, and the sliding frame 5 drives the movable mold 6 to move downward to close the mold. After the injection is completed, the staff starts the oil pump 15, and the oil pump 15 sucks the heat-conducting oil into the oil outlet pipe 16. Then the heat-conducting oil flows into the heat-conducting pipe 10 on the front side, and then the heat-conducting oil flows into the heat-conducting pipe 10 on the rear side through the guide pipe 18. The filter element 22 can filter the impurities in the heat-conducting oil. The heat-conducting oil can cool the static mold 3 and the movable mold 6, so that the injection molded parts are cooled and solidified. Finally, the heat-conducting oil flows back to the oil tank 13 through the return pipe 17. The heat-conducting oil can drive the impeller 12 to rotate, and the impeller 12 drives the screw shaft 11 to rotate, and the screw shaft 11 can stir the heat-conducting oil. , so that the heat transfer oil forms a complex flow pattern 6, breaking the laminar boundary layer in the static state, so that more heat transfer oil can contact the surface of the static mold 3 and the dynamic mold 6, improving the heat exchange efficiency, thereby improving the overall cooling efficiency. When the filter element 22 needs to be replaced, the staff pulls the sealing sleeve 20 to move the two sealing sleeves 20 away from each other, so that the sealing sleeve 20 and the filter element 22 are out of contact, the spring 21 is compressed, and then the filter element 22 is removed and replaced with a new filter element 22, so that the new filter element 22 and the guide tube 18 correspond, and then the sealing sleeve 20 is loosened. Under the action of the spring 21, the two sealing sleeves 20 move towards each other, so that the sealing sleeve 20 is put on the new filter element 22. The sealing sleeve 20 can seal the gap between the guide tube 18 and the filter element 22 to prevent leakage of heat transfer oil.

[0042] After the injection molding is completed, the staff starts the air cooler 23, and the air cooler 23 fills the cold air into the first air outlet pipe 24. The cold air enters the wavy groove 27 through the second air outlet pipe 25. The cold air flows along the wavy groove 27. The wavy groove 27 can disperse the heat flow path, reduce local hot spots, avoid excessive temperature gradients, and thus reduce the risk of thermal stress. Finally, the cold air will be discharged from the wavy groove 27.
